2.4.2.23 Skip Empty Lines
You can choose to have the Braille Sense Plus B32 read a blank line,
or to skip empty lines. The shortcut key is “e (dots 1-5),” and the
default is set to “off.” If you keep the default setting, you will hear the
words “empty line” if there is a blank line. The “space” key toggles
off/on. If you choose to turn this option on, the Braille Sense Plus
B32 will skip all blank lines, and you will not hear the words “empty
line” when there is a blank line. If you have changed the setting,
press the “enter” key to save the setting. You can also “tab (“space-
4-5”)” or “shift-tab (“space-1-2”)” to the “confirm” button, and press
“enter.” If you do not want to save the setting, “tab (“space-4-5”)” or
“shift-tab (“space-1-2”)” to the “cancel” button, and then press “enter.”
You can also cancel saving the setting by pressing “space–z (dots 1-
3-5-6)” or “space-e (dots 1-5).”
2.4.2.24 Control Information
You can choose the display location of information regarding the files
and menus in the Braille Sense Plus B32. The short cut key is “I (dots
2-4),” and the default is set to “before.” To toggle “control information”
between before, after and off, press “space.
If you select “before,” you will hear control information before a menu
or list item. If you select “after,” you will hear control information such
as “list item” or “menu item” after a menu or list item. If you have
control information shut off, you will not hear “list item” or “menu
item.”
Note that if the web browser is activated, the control symbols will
appear even if you turn off the “control information” option.
If you have changed the setting, press the “enter” key to save the
setting. You can also “tab (“space-4-5”)” or “shift-tab (“space-1-2”)” to
the “confirm” button, and press “enter.” If you do not want to save the
setting, “tab (“space-4-5”)” or “shift-tab (“space-1-2”)” to the “cancel”
button, and then press “enter.” You can also cancel saving the
setting by pressing “space–z (dots 1-3-5-6)” or “space-e (dots 1-5).”
